Bridge Collapses In Shendam LGA of Plateau After Heavy Downpour

By Israel Adamu,Jos

A Bridge linking Total in Shendam local government council of Plateau state has collapsed following heavy downpour .

Our correspondent gathered that the bridge collapsed on Sunday afternoon.

Aliyu Baga, a resident of Shendam LGA of Plateau state who confirmed the development to our correspondent said although no life was lost ,he lamented that the collapse of the bridge would inflict more hardship on the people of the Local government council.

In his words ” The people of the LGA have to look for alternate road to go into the town and other local government councils .

” It is the only bridge that eases the movement of farm inputs and all other important economic and social activities in our Local government ,he appealed to relevant authorities to come to the rescue of the people of the council .

He added that the bridge was constructed around 1970 .
